Specifications
Turn On Voltage (Max): 6.75 VDC
Coil Resistance: 97 Ohms
Coil Power: 900 mW
Contact Material: Silver Cadmium Oxide (AgCdO)
Operating Temperature: -55°C ~ 105°C
Termination Style: PC Pin
Mounting Type: Through Hole
Features: Insulation - Class F, Sealed - Fully
Release Time: 10ms
Operate Time: 15ms
Turn Off Voltage (Min): 0.9 VDC
Series: G8P
Switching Voltage: 250VAC, 28VDC - Max
Contact Rating (Current): 10A
Contact Form: SPDT (1 Form C)
Coil Voltage: 9VDC
Coil Current: 93.0mA
Coil Type: Non Latching
Relay Type: General Purpose
Part Status: Obsolete
Packaging: Bulk

Working Principle

The G8P-1C4P DC9 power relay works by using a low voltage or signal to control a higher voltage or current. This is accomplished by using a coil, also known as an electromagnet, to create a magnetic field. The magnetic field in turn attracts a movable piece called an armature which, when connected to the circuit, closes the circuit and allows current to flow. When the coil is de-energized, the armature is no longer attracted to the magnet and the circuit is opened.The G8P-1C4P DC9 power relay is designed to be highly efficient and reliable.
